The annual spring concerts of the Catholic Choral Society of Scranton celebrating the 75th Anniversary of the choral group will be presented on Friday evening, May 17 at 7:00 PM at Mary Mother of God Parish at Holy Rosary Church at 316 William Street in Scranton and on Sunday evening , May 19 at 7:00 PM at the Church of St. Ignatius Loyola at 339 N. Maple Ave., Kingston, PA.
On Friday evening, May 17, at Holy Rosary Church, the Choral Society will host The Forest City Regional High School Chamber Singers directed by District 9 PMEA President Alison Yuravich. On Sunday evening, May 19, at St. Ignatius Loyola Church , the Choral Society will host the Good Shepherd Academy Junior High Choir of Kingston under the direction of Thomas Hanlon.
The Catholic Choral Society, marking its 75th season, is comprised of members from Luzerne, Lackawanna, Wayne, Susquehanna and Wyoming counties. The director of the Catholic Choral Society is Ann Manganiello and the accompanist is Linda Houck. Brenda Grunza, Nicholson, and Lois Ostrowski, Pittston, are co-presidents of the choral group.
Tickets: Adults $10.00 – Seniors and students $8.00 –Singers and ages 12 and under free.
